And yet, for every report of a problem, someone seems to know a solution, whether it be technique or the right tool for the job. Skeptic that I am, you might think I would doubt all these solutions, but I know them to be real.

For tubulars the overnight stretch, the warming of the tire in the sun or with a hair dryer, and now the gluing tape all combine to make the problems literally disappear.

For clinchers with and without tubes, bead jacks like the Koolstop and the VAR completely eliminate the mounting problems. Some folks are too proud to employ a bead jack, but there is no accounting for that. Stubborn refusal to use a best practice or a magical tool is just cutting off one's nose to spite one's face.
